2013-07-09 3 views
1

Я хочу сделать игру с друзьями в iOS, Android, WP операционных системах. Мы решили использовать cocos2d-x и разработать ядро ​​игры на C++. Каким будет правильный способ развития, чтобы мы могли одновременно вместе писать игру, а просто строить проект по-разному на каждой платформе.

Мы думали написать ядро ​​игры в C++ в Visual Studio, но есть проблема: как мы можем быстро протестировать ее на каждой платформе? Как люди обычно разрабатывают многоплатформенные проекты ?.

Также мы хотели бы услышать некоторые рекомендации об управлении источником всего проекта. Заранее спасибо.Cocos2d-x разработка кроссплатформенной игры

ответ

2

Лучший способ развить игру на Кокосовые 2DX является

  • Разработка Полная Игра для одной платформы, скорее всего, IOS или Windows.
  • Поверните свою игру на другие платформы. Исправлены мелкие ошибки.
  • Вы можете использовать GitHub для работы в группах.
  • Убедитесь, что вы проверить свои приложения на устройствах, потому что некоторые функции конкретной платформы, как реклама и т.д.
1

Для управления версиями у вас есть несколько опций, таких как Git или SVN. Лично мне очень нравится Git, поскольку он не требует центрального сервера, поскольку он равноправный. Это означает, что если все идет не так с вашим хостом, у вас все еще есть полная копия. Что касается хорошего хостинга и размещения репозитория, я бы посмотрел на https://bitbucket.org/

0

Чтобы проверить на iOS, я считаю, что вам лучше получить Mac вместо окна.